# Build Provenance: UI Snapshot Tests

Hey future maintainer — welcome to the Glimmerdash snapshot setup. Every UI component in `packages/widgets` gets a rendered snapshot at build time, and the CI stage refuses to publish if any snapshot drifts without an approved update commit. Don't be the person who blanket-approves 400 diffs at once; we've been burned by that on the Ashvale theme refactor. Snapshots are hashed into the provenance manifest so we can tie any screenshot back to its build. That token is recorded just below.

session token of yahof-bajeg = htk9_0d43d44ed

Subject: Pooler cut-over complete

For future maintainers: we cut the Ostreld API over to the shared connection pooler on Tuesday. Direct database connections are now forbidden; everything routes through the pooler tier. Connection storms during deploys are gone, and idle connection count fell from ~900 to ~60. The pooler runs with the configuration recorded below.

config for kafof-bawef:
holath:
  log_level: debug
  metrics_host: metrics.holath.qorvelsys.internal
  pin: 2191
  pool_size: 32

Onboarding note for the Ledgerpane admin table: bulk edits are applied through the batcher service, not directly against the database. Select rows, choose an action, and the batcher stages changes in a pending set you can review before commit. Edits over 500 rows require a second approver — this is enforced server-side, so don't try to chunk around it. To run the batcher locally you need the staging write credential, which goes in your .env as the next line.

secret setting of bahip-kagag: RELAY_SECRET3=c83

Meeting notes — SDK parity review

Compared the Wrenfold client SDKs for Corvid and Aspenline runtimes. Gaps: Aspenline lacks certificate pinning and the token-refresh backoff added to Corvid last quarter. Security concern flagged: divergent TLS defaults could let older Aspenline builds negotiate weaker ciphers. Agreed to freeze new features until parity on auth and transport is reached, with a tracking matrix updated weekly. The parity workstream and its security checklist are owned by the engineer named below.

named custodian: Brivan Eliath Quenox Frador